Corrections

In the April 1 issue of Our Town, the article titled “In the ring – Eight file for four seats on SFSD Board” should have referred to Jo Tucker by the personal pronoun “she.” 

The article should have also included a brief biography on Eliza Torlyn.  She has raised her children in the district and has served on the SFSD Bond Advisory Committee, Superintendent Listening Session Workgroup, Long Range Facility Planning Committee, and served as Butte Creek PTT President. This would be her first time in elected public office.

Our Town apologies for these errors.
